I haven't been out this year but can usually manage a handful or two from Pinaus. I think the trick is in the technique. 90percent of the time I fish within 6" of the bottom. Use a very small tungsten jig with either a couple maggots or mealworm. Jig for 15 seconds and then hold dead still (sometimes I'll set my rod on a little pile of ice) for 30 seconds and repeat. I watch my line when holding still for the slightest movement and set the hook when I see it. If I haven't caught one in 10 mins I move. I realize I'm a bit late but for next time.
